Guide to school and area statistics

A short key for the statistics shown on this page for PO21. We have not listed house prices, broadband, green space or similar extras here unless they appear in the neighbourhood and area context section.

School listings

What you see on each school card

Only fields that appear on at least one school on this page are listed. Hover a stat row when you see a question mark for a one-line reminder.

School type
How the school is run β€” for example academy, council-maintained, voluntary aided or free school.
Trust
The multi-academy trust or sponsor running the school, where it is an academy.
Age range
Year groups on roll β€” for example 4–11 for primary, or 11–18 with sixth form.
Ofsted
Latest published inspection grade, inspection date where we have it, and a link to the school’s page on the Ofsted reports site.
Straight-line miles
Distance as the crow flies from your home postcode when you have entered one, otherwise from the middle of this district. Not walking or driving time.
Walking, cycling and park-and-stride hints
Rough bands from straight-line miles: about 1 mile or less may suit walking; about 1–2.5 miles we show cycling and park-and-stride; over about 2.5 miles park-and-stride only. Not checked routes or journey times.
Pupils
Number of pupils on roll from published school census data.
Free school meals
Share of pupils eligible for free school meals.
SEN
Share of pupils with SEN support or an Education, Health and Care plan.
SEN provision
Extra on-site support such as a resourced provision or SEN unit.
English as an additional language (EAL)
Share of pupils whose first language is not English, where recorded.
Attendance
Share of possible sessions attended. Higher is better.
Persistent absence
Share of pupils missing 10% or more of sessions. Lower is better.
Admissions pressure
Indicative label from recent applications versus places β€” oversubscribed, about average or often has spaces.
Attainment
Primary: share meeting the expected standard in reading, writing and maths (Key Stage 2). Secondary: Progress 8. A dash means nothing was published for that school.
Attainment vs local
Compares each school’s headline to others of the same phase on this page β€” above, below or about average for the district.
